PHP文章采集实战:选工具、写规则、处理异常
优采云 发布时间: 2024-01-01 02:57本文详细分享了关于使用PHP编写文章采集代码方面的实用方法与实践智慧。重点内容包括选取理想的采集工具以及如何编写正确有效的采集规则,并对可能出现的异常状况进行妥善处理。
1.选择合适的采集工具
在选摘文章时,适宜的采集工具尤为关键哦!例如,PHP Simple HTML DOM Parser就能满足您的需求;根据具体情况挑选吧。
2.编写采集规则
写好采集规则是文章采集成功的关键一步。我们建议您首先详细地分析目标网站的HTML架构与URL规范,然后再考虑利用XPath或者正则表达式去精准定位,进而高效地提取所需内容。
3.处理异常情况
在收集文章的过程中,难免遭遇网络中断或目标站点变更等状况。此时,我们可通过设置适当的超时时间、设计多次尝试策略以及定期审查规则等方法来妥善应对此类问题。
4.数据清洗和处理
在我们完成文章采集之后,所取得的数据或许会有些许冗余或用途不明的部分,故此,我们需要对这些数据进行细致的清理与处理工作。而在此过程中,您可轻松利用PHP所提供的全面丰富的字符串函数以及强大的正则表达式工具,以此更好地满足您的特定需求。
5.定时采集
为了保证我们文章的及时更新,建议您执行定期采集操作,这可以采用定时任务来实现。在Linux系统上,推荐使用Cron;而在Windows环境下,则可以尝试计划任务功能!
6.数据存储和展示
在完成文章采集之后,我们需要妥善保管这些数据,并以友好的方式呈现给大家。为此,您可以选择使用合适的数据库如MySQL或MongoDB来保存数据,而用PHP编写的网页可展示清晰的采集中间数据。
7.遵守法律法规
尊敬的读者们,在阅读和分享文章时,我们必须遵循相应的法律规定,尊重作者原有的著作权。请不要随意复制或传播他人作品,以维护知识产权的尊严。
掌握了这些窍门和心得,相信您会更顺利地运用PHP代码处理文章采集任务,成功解锁所需内容。期待这篇文章能给您带来好运!